This year we hosted Thanksgiving dinner for 11 including our family of 6 with 5 neighbors/friends. I reused Halloween pumpkins for our Thanksgiving decor. Ornamental cabbage surrounds more left over pumpkins. I found a succulent wreath on sale at Lowe's. Orange tulips for the guest bathroom.Our mantel was simply decorated with candles and fruit. This was our first large gathering at the farm table my husband made. I bought bouquets of fresh flowers at Trader Joe's and arranged them in sections for our centerpiece. Pears and grapes were washed and added to the flower arrangement for guests to enjoy as they awaited the main course.The glass hens I purchased several years ago at Target served salad to each guest. The coffee mugs and matching bread/dessert plates were purchased at Home Goods. The ivory metal lace chargers were bought at an antique shop several years ago.
